I have a new horse and my saddle is tiny bit wide at the withers. I have a 5 Star and love it BUT it allows it to tip slightly forward when cinched. What saddle pads would help with this? I did shim it but couldn't get it just right with the 5 Star. CSI, CE Biofit, Saddlerite, etc.?

I really like my The corrector pad. the shims aren't too bulky and you can place them where you need them at. If you need more thickness you can add more shims to that area.
